Product Description
Set of templates; includes lines, wheel chair, coloring rectangle for under wheel chair figure; HO scale; each template approx. 3.73"L x 2.02"W x .05" thick; arrives unpainted with a white, versatile plastic finish only. I use a "stampin''" chalk marker purchased at stampinup.com under ink/markers. Tape down the coloring rectangle template onto the desired location using blue painter's tape. Outline the rectangle with a pencil and paint the lane lines with the stampin chalk marker. The marker ink drys quickly and you may want to re-coat it a couple of times. Remove the tape and template and align strips of blue masking tape along the outside perimeter of the box. Mask off everything else outside the box with newspaper, etc. and spray the inside of the box with royal blue paint. When the paint drys, remove all masking. Next, align and tape-down the handicap emblem, aligning the template with the new lane lines. Paint the emblem by tracing the inside with the chalk marker. If you desire, paint over the white lane lines with a sharp blue marker.
